Bill Beauchesne joined Baker Newman Noyes in 2002. He is a Senior Manager
in the firm's Tax Division specializing in business and individual
federal and state compliance and consulting, and cost segregation studies.
Bill earned a Bachelor of Science degree in Accounting from Boston College,
a Bachelor of Science degree in Management Information Systems from Boston
College, and an MS in Taxation from Northeastern University.
